2. CLIENT-CONNECTED BUSINESS DATA (ADS, ANALYTICS, AND OTHER CONNECTED ACCOUNTS)
In Short: When a client connects their own third-party account, we access only what they authorize, via the platform's official API, to analyze their data and provide them insights. We act as a processor on the client's behalf.
MAG OS is a business-to-business platform used by agencies and brands ("Clients"). A core function is allowing a Client to connect their own third-party accounts so MAG OS can read that data on that Client's behalf and surface analysis and insights back to that Client.
What we access. With the Client's explicit authorization, and limited to the permissions the Client grants, we may access read-only data from connected accounts, including:
- Advertising accounts (e.g., Meta Ads, Google Ads, TikTok Ads): campaign/ad set/ad structure and names, performance metrics (spend, impressions, reach, clicks, and derived metrics), reported results/conversions, and associated dates.
- Analytics accounts (e.g., Google Analytics): site/marketing performance metrics for the Client's own properties.
- Other connected sources a Client chooses to link.
How we use it. Solely to provide analytics and insights to the Client who owns the connected account — analyzing their marketing performance against their goals. Our advertising integrations are read-only; we do not create, edit, or manage campaigns.
Our role and commitments.
- We act as a data processor / service provider on the Client's instructions; the Client is the controller of their connected data.
- We access connected data only via the platform's official API under the Client's own authorization (OAuth), and only for accounts the Client explicitly connects.
- Per-Client isolation: each Client's connected data and access credentials are stored separately and are never pooled with, or made accessible to, other Clients. Access tokens are stored encrypted.
- We do not sell connected data, do not use one Client's connected data to benefit another Client, and do not use it for advertising targeting or cross-Client profiling.
- A Client may disconnect a connected account at any time, which stops further access; we then delete or de-identify the associated data per our retention practices.
Platform-specific (Meta). Consistent with Meta's Platform Terms and Developer Policies, Meta advertising data is accessed only with the Client's authorization via Meta's official API, limited to granted permissions (read-only), used only to provide analytics/insights to the Client, and never sold, transferred, or used for cross-Client profiling.
Platform-specific (Google). Our use of Google Ads and Google Analytics data received through Google APIs adheres to the Google API Services User Data Policy, including the Limited Use requirements. Google user data is used only to provide and improve the Client-facing features that the Client authorized, and is not transferred or used except as those requirements allow.

12. CONTROLS FOR DO-NOT-TRACK FEATURES
Most browsers and some mobile OS/apps include a Do-Not-Track ("DNT") feature. No uniform technology standard for recognizing DNT signals has been finalized, so we do not currently respond to them. California law requires us to disclose this; because there is no industry/legal standard, we do not respond to DNT signals at this time.
